I think it was safe to do with previous Mavics, i.e. Mavic Pro or Mavic 2 Pro maybe as I think there used to be even accessories for holding the drone folded in the hands for using it as a stationary camera replacement. But imho it seems it has changed with Mavic 3 because the bottom legs rub against the gimbal restricting its movement. I suspect it's safer to unfold it to give the gimbal the breathing space even though they seem to have removed gimbal initialization with Mavic 3 on startup now, if you tilt the drone while moving it or place it on uneven surface, it may require gimbal to also titl, but it will get stuck rubbing against bottom arm(s). Not 100% sure, but I think maybe the safest would be to unfold it.
